Institute of Graduate Studies and Research Management Information Systems Department; Includes bibliography (sheets 55-59) N2 - ABSTRACT How students perceive learning analytic services in higher education is essential. This is because they are the beneficiary of learning analytic, and it is crucial to know what they expect in order to serve them better. This research examines students' ideal (what they truly want from LA) and forecasted expectations (what students believe the school will be able to give). Through an online survey, we gathered data from 392 students at Cyprus International University. The employed questionnaire dubbed the Students Expectation of Learning Analytics Questionnaire (SELAQ), comprises two component structures that best accounted for the information relating to ideal and predicted expectations. A Latent Class Analysis was done on the data using the poLCA function in the R! Program. Separate studies were performed on the Ideal and Expected expectations. The findings demonstrated that although students' ideal expectations of LA were greater than their predicted expectations, the difference was not statistically significant.
